技术文摘
响应式布局框架的五大选择探索
响应式布局框架的五大选择探索
在当今数字化时代,响应式布局已成为网站和应用开发的关键要素。它能确保内容在各种设备上都能呈现出最佳效果,为用户带来一致的体验。以下是对响应式布局框架五大选择的探索。
Bootstrap是最受欢迎的响应式布局框架之一。它提供了丰富的CSS类和JavaScript插件,能快速搭建响应式网站。其网格系统灵活强大,能轻松实现页面的布局和排版。而且,Bootstrap拥有庞大的社区支持,开发者可以轻松获取文档、教程和各种扩展插件,大大提高开发效率。
Foundation也是一个优秀的选择。它注重语义化和灵活性,提供了比Bootstrap更多的定制选项。Foundation的网格系统可以根据不同的屏幕尺寸进行自适应调整,同时它还支持多种排版样式和交互效果。对于追求个性化和独特设计的开发者来说,Foundation能满足他们的需求。
Materialize则以其简洁美观的设计风格脱颖而出。它基于Google的Material Design设计理念,采用卡片式布局和动态交互效果,给用户带来现代感十足的体验。Materialize的组件丰富多样,易于使用,能帮助开发者快速创建出具有吸引力的界面。
Semantic UI强调语义化的HTML结构,使代码更易于理解和维护。它的布局和组件都具有清晰的语义,开发者可以根据语义来编写代码,提高开发效率。Semantic UI还提供了丰富的主题和样式定制选项,方便开发者打造符合品牌形象的界面。
最后是Tailwind CSS,它采用了实用主义的CSS编写方式,提供了大量的原子类。开发者可以通过组合这些原子类来构建页面布局和样式,实现高度的定制化。Tailwind CSS的响应式设计功能强大,能轻松适应各种设备。
选择合适的响应式布局框架对于项目的成功至关重要。开发者需要根据项目的具体需求、设计风格和团队的技术水平等因素来综合考虑,以找到最适合的框架。
- 5 月 Github 热门的 JavaScript 开源项目
- Python 仅用三十行代码实现简单人工语音对话
- 5G 时代远程全息呈现成发展方向,AR/VR 硬件迎量变期
- VR 游戏的乱象:伤害频现、暴力横行与恐怖元素对低龄儿童的吸引
- 别用 a.equals(b) 判断对象相等,强烈不建议!
- Vuex 入门必看:先码住这篇笔记!
- 面部识别的利弊:福祸之辨
- 嵌入式开发中输出调试与日志信息的若干方法
- 一日一技:同时结束多个线程的两种办法
- 解析 Golang 语言 Method 接收者的值类型与指针类型
- C# 能否在 PC 上经蓝牙向手机发送数据?
- Python 3.5 带来的便捷矩阵及其他改进
- Axios 进阶封装的项目实践
- Node.js 中 Accept 时 Emfile 的处理策略
- Loki 源码中日志写入的分析